Risk Management Strategies for Tech Projects

To be honest, tech projects don’t always go as per the plan. A feature takes longer than expected, a new update breaks something, the budget starts getting stretched, or client requirements suddenly change. This is simply part of the tech job. This is where risk management strategies for tech projects become critical.

All technology projects create uncertainty, from developing a new mobile app and launching a SaaS platform to upgrading systems or migrating to the cloud. Technical challenges, delays, cost issues, security threats, or lack of team communication can be the real obstacles. Neglecting these risks can result in small issues escalating to big problems in no time.

Strong risk management strategies don’t mean to expect the worst. They mean being prepared. This helps teams identify potential problems early on, recognize their severity, and take intelligent measures to mitigate them. Teams can push ahead with focus and assurance, instead of continuing to respond to issues.

In this guide, we’ll cover practical and easily actionable risk management strategies for tech projects to help you get more comfortable with uncertainty, whether at the beginning or throughout a project’s life cycle.

Risk Management Strategies

Risk management strategies are simple plans that help teams prepare for what could go wrong on a project. Rather than waiting for problems to arise, teams seek to identify potential risks early — such as technical challenges, delays, or budget issues — and prepare responses. By planning and preparing ahead of time, teams can reduce the severity of these issues and maintain forward progress on the project. On the whole, risk management strategies make projects more systematic, resilient, and manageable.

Why Risk Management Strategies for Tech Projects Are Important

Below are some key reasons why risk management strategies for tech projects are important:

1. Helps identify potential problems early

Risk management strategies allow teams to identify potential problems like tech breakdowns, delays, and budget issues before they can escalate.

2. Reduces project delays

By prepping teams to handle challenges in advance, risks can be mitigated and handled more quickly, keeping the project on track.

3. Controls project costs

Unexpected problems can increase expenses. A good strategy for risk management avoids overspending and ensures the budget is managed responsibly.

4. Improves decision-making

The project managers will be able to make informed decisions and better decisions for the deciding parts during its lifecycle with clear risk plans.

5. Enhances team coordination

Teams communicate more effectively and remain aligned when everyone knows there’s potential risk involved, as well as a plan to mitigate it.

6. Increases project success rate

Companies are better equipped to finish tech projects on time and within budget by preparing for uncertainties.

Types of Risks in Tech Projects

Types of Risks in Tech Projects

Technology projects involve multiple stages such as planning, development, testing, and deployment. During these stages, different types of risks can arise that may affect the project’s timeline, budget, or overall success. Understanding these risks helps teams prepare better and manage challenges effectively. 

Below are some common types of risks in tech projects:

Technical RisksBudget and Cost Risks
Issues related to software performance, system failures, integration problems, bugs, or outdated technologies that can impact the functionality of the project.These risks occur when the project exceeds the planned budget due to poor cost estimation, unexpected challenges, or additional project requirements.
Timeline and Scheduling RisksSecurity and Compliance Risks
Delays occur when tasks take longer than expected because of unclear requirements, limited resources, or technical challenges during development.Risks related to data breaches, cyber threats, or failure to follow legal regulations and industry compliance standards.

Read more:- How to Set Realistic Timelines for Software Projects?

Best Risk Management Strategies Used by Successful Tech Teams

The best tech teams know that risks will always be a natural part of any project. They cannot afford to bury their heads in the sand; instead, they implement well-defined strategies to identify, control, and minimize potential problems before those issues get a chance to dance with the project. Ensuring teams are organized with effective decision-making and managing tech project risk keeps development on track. Here are some of the top risk management strategies that successful tech teams use:

1. Early Risk Identification

Successful teams are even adept at identifying risks early on in a project. By analyzing requirements, technologies, and resources up front, they can forecast potential challenges and develop solutions in advance.

2. Regular Risk Assessment

Tech teams continuously perform risk assessments throughout the project lifecycle. Regular reviews provide insight for teams on how serious a risk is and if new risks have arisen during development.

3. Clear Communication and Collaboration

Silo-free communication between team members, project managers, and stakeholders ensures that risks are highlighted during the collaboration and mitigated quickly. Transparency decreases confusion and increases decision-making.

4. Creating Risk Mitigation Plans

The top teams had contingency plans to limit the effects of potential risks. These plans include contingencies, reallocating resources, and timeline adjustments in the event of a problem.

5. Continuous Monitoring and Adaptation

Successful teams regularly keep track of project progress and modify their strategies as necessary. This enables them to react quickly to unplanned changes and ensure the continuing progress of the project.

Also Read:- Why Many Software Projects Fail?

How to Create a Risk Management Plan for Tech Projects (Step-by-Step)

Steps to create Risk Management Plan for Tech Projects

This type of strong risk management plan for tech projects helps a team stay prepared to respond properly in case the forecast goes wrong. Rather than being reactive when problems arise, a structured first principles approach allows teams to proactively identify, evaluate, and manage risks early. Here are the key steps that successful tech teams take to create an effective risk management plan.

1. Start with Smart Risk Identification

The first thing in any risk management strategy for tech projects is to identify potential risks. Reviewing project requirements, technology stacks, timelines, and resources would help teams identify possible roadblocks. Identifying risk early helps to stop small problems from becoming big roadblocks for a project.

2. Evaluate and Prioritize the Risks

Step 2: Assess Probability and Impact of Risks. After you identify risks Not all risks are equally grave. Ranking risks as High Impact, High Probability helps teams to invest their precious time more wisely.

3. Build Effective Risk Mitigation Strategies

After evaluating the risks, teams should create concise risk mitigation strategies. This could involve building contingency plans, enhancing test procedures, deploying more resources, or modifying timelines. The mitigation plan aims to minimize disruption throughout the project lifecycle.

4. Assign Ownership and Responsibility

There must be a person/team responsible for each of the identified risks. Ownership ensures accountability and streamlines the process of responding quickly to risks hitting the project.

5. Monitor, Review, and Adapt Continuously

Risk management does not stop at planning. Effective tech teams monitor project progress on an ongoing basis, track existing risks within the project as well as discover new ones when needed throughout the course of the project. Frequent reviews allow teams to adjust risk management approaches for tech projects and ensure the project stays on schedule.

Conclusion

Technology projects can add uncertainty in all manner from technical challenges to budget and timeline issues. Hence, tech project risk management strategies are essential for successful project execution. When teams proactively assess their environment for potential obstacles, they can better plan, make more informed choices, and minimize disruptions as everything unfolds over the lifecycle of the project.

Effective risk management strategies can prevent drastically reduced revenues, but they also enhance team cohesion and the stability of your project. A proactive approach to risk management increases the likelihood of successful, good-quality technology projects being completed on time and to budget.

Advait Upadhyay

Advait Upadhyay (Co-Founder & Managing Director)

Advait Upadhyay is the co-founder of Talentelgia Technologies and brings years of real-world experience to the table. As a tech enthusiast, he’s always exploring the emerging landscape of technology and loves to share his insights through his blog posts. Advait enjoys writing because he wants to help business owners and companies create apps that are easy to use and meet their needs. He’s dedicated to looking for new ways to improve, which keeps his team motivated and helps make sure that clients see them as their go-to partner for custom web and mobile software development. Advait believes strongly in working together as one united team to achieve common goals, a philosophy that has helped build Talentelgia Technologies into the company it is today.
View More About Advait Upadhyay
India

Dibon Building, Ground Floor, Plot No ITC-2, Sector 67 Mohali, Punjab (160062)

Business: +91-814-611-1801
USA

7110 Station House Rd Elkridge MD 21075

Business: +1-240-751-5525
Dubai

DDP, Building A1, IFZA Business Park - Dubai Silicon Oasis - Dubai - UAE

Business: +971 565-096-650
Australia

G01, 8 Merriville Road, Kellyville Ridge NSW 2155, Australia

call-icon